Paradoxical Direction
|
a technique used where the client is directed to continue to engage in the particular behavior that s/he is trying to eliminate. This technique is used to make the client aware of the behavior and to provide the client with a sense of control over the behavior

Reflection
|
technique used by social workers to clarify and provoke further thgouth regarding the cilent's current feelings to help the clinet better understand those feelings
